Who we are
HeyRegs is a loyalty card service for independent hospitality businesses in Australia and New Zealand, operated from 8 The Drive, Epsom, Auckland, New Zealand.
This page covers two different groups of people, and it matters which one you are.
- Merchants are business owners who sign up to build a card.
- Customers are the people who add a merchant’s card to their phone wallet.
What we collect
From merchants
- Business name, your name, email address, and optionally a mobile number.
- Your town and country, and what sort of business you run.
- Photographs you upload, such as your logo, shopfront, or menu, which we process to build your card.
- Billing details, handled by our payment processor. We do not see or store your full card number.
From your customers
Deliberately very little: a name and one contact field, either an email address or a mobile number. Plus the record of their visits: when a stamp or point was added, and when a reward was redeemed.
We also record when someone agreed to be contacted, and on what basis. That timestamp is a legal requirement, not a preference.
Why we collect it
- To build your card. Photographs are processed to read colours, isolate your logo, and lay out a wallet pass. We keep them while your card is live so it can be rebuilt or edited, and delete them when your account closes.
- To run the programme. Stamps, points and rewards need a record of visits, or the card cannot work.
- To contact people who agreed to be contacted. Merchants who sign up, and customers who ticked the box when they joined a card.
- To take payment and meet our tax and record-keeping obligations.
How long we keep it
We keep your account records for as long as your account is open. When an account closes we delete it and the customer records held under it, other than financial records we are required by law to keep.
Your rights
You can ask us what we hold about you, ask us to correct it, and ask us to delete it. Write to the address below and we will respond as quickly as we can, and within the time limits set by the Australian Privacy Act 1988 and the New Zealand Privacy Act 2020.
In Australia, this is governed by the Privacy Act 1988 and the Australian Privacy Principles. If you are unhappy with how we have handled a request, you can complain to the Office of the Australian Information Commissioner.
In New Zealand, the Privacy Act 2020 applies and you can complain to the Office of the Privacy Commissioner.
Marketing messages always carry an unsubscribe link, and unsubscribing takes effect regardless of anything else in this page.
